WordPress is an open-source content management system based on PHP and MySQL. The platform helps to create, edit, and publish a website and or blog content. WordPress developer is responsible for creating adaptive and responsive designs,  front-end as well as back-end web development, and should have strong knowledge of scripting languages such as HTML, JavaScript, CSS, jQuery, etc. In addition, candidate should be  aware of all the technical aspects of the content management system. Question:

Consider the following scenario:

You installed a WordPress theme about a month ago and since then, you have made several modifications to the theme files in order to give your website a very unique look and feel. This customization took so much time and effort but it is well worth it.

Now, following an alert that states that an update is available for your theme, you quickly updated your theme only to discover that all your theme changes are gone.

Which of the given options could have prevented the same from happening?
 


Options

  • Nothing! Whenever you update your theme, you lose all of your previous changes.
  • Using WordPress' built-in editor for making changes instead of third party editors
  • Committing all changes made before beginning an update
  • Installing a Child Theme and making your changes on it
